
Phillies vs. Cardinals Prediction, Odds, Picks - April 11
Bryce Harper and Brendan Donovan will be among the star attractions when the Philadelphia Phillies face the St. Louis Cardinals on Friday at 8:15 p.m. ET, at Busch Stadium. The Cardinals are listed as -104 moneyline underdogs for this matchup with the favorite Phillies (-115). Philadelphia is the favorite on the run line (-1.5). The over/under for the contest is listed at 7.5 runs.

Phillies Player Insights
- Kyle Schwarber has racked up a team-best batting average of .283, and leads the Phillies in home runs (six) and runs batted in (12).
- Schwarber's home runs place him first in the majors, and he ranks 10th in RBI.
- Harper is hitting .267 with two doubles, two home runs and 10 walks.
- Of all major league hitters, Harper ranks 56th in homers and 104th in RBI.
- Nick Castellanos is hitting .273 with three doubles, two home runs and four walks.
- Trea Turner has two doubles, a home run and six walks while hitting .270.
- Turner brings a three-game streak with at least one hit into this one. During his last five outings he is hitting .238 with a double, a home run, three walks and an RBI.

Cardinals Player Insights
- Donovan paces the Cardinals with a team-leading batting average of .375.
- Donovan's home run total places him 56th in the big leagues, and he is 22nd in RBI.
- Donovan takes a hitting streak of six games into this game. In his last 10 games he is batting .375 with three doubles, two home runs, four walks and eight RBI.
- Nolan Arenado is batting .310 with three doubles, a home run and eight walks.
- Arenado is currently 103rd in homers and 80th in RBI in the major leagues.
- Lars Nootbaar is hitting .271 with a double, two home runs and eight walks.
- Victor Scott II has two doubles, a triple, a home run and five walks while batting .286.
